Default Floridas Top Mile Speed Event

The first to bring you Top Mile Speed in Florida, MileMarker-1 will be hosting it's second event January 3, 2010 at the Dade Collier Airport. TAG Heuer equipment will be used to accurately handle mph readings, more food vendors, more port o potties, etc
The weather for January is mid 70s during the day, which will make for a pleasurable day.

Jeepers I'm in again too. I'll be swapping my 4.11 rear to my 3.23 rear. I should have my 30th package stripe done too. I found my problem with the coolant. I drilled 4 holes in the Tstat and at high constant rpms it would blow the coolant out the res tank. Never did it on the dyno or ever before but this seems to make sense. I'm in Ft. Laud, you?
